Quality assurance testing for video games includes thoroughly testing video games before release to the public. The goal is to ensure there are no technical issues or errors before customers play the game. Does the product meet the quality standards and requirements? Is a bug recurring or a one-time problem that appears under certain conditions?
Quality assurance testers for video games create test plans to search for (and find) these potential errors. Then, they suggest improvements and new features to developers. Once the video game is out on the market, there’s no turning back, so you and the team should ensure everything is ready beforehand.
Your primary task is to play the entire game multiple times, testing different scenarios and features to identify and report bugs. For example, you can play the game on both Android and iOS devices to determine if there’s a recurring bug on both platforms.
As a video game QA tester, you also work closely with developers to provide feedback and suggest improvements and features. What do you think players would appreciate when playing? Do you think the game meets the expectations of the playing base? Being a regular gamer yourself is a plus when trying to land a job testing video games.
As a QA video game tester, you must master some tools to become the best in your field. For starters, you need to become familiar with game development software like Unity and Unreal Engine. Also, case management software like JIRA or Zephyr comes in handy when tracking test cases and reporting bugs. Any tool that helps you log and track bugs and test hardware is a must to land a good job. These include Bugzilla, Mantis, and more.
Needless to say, you need a basic understanding of coding and programming languages. While it’s not a requirement for some jobs, it helps video game QA testers understand how developers build games and find bugs more easily. The most popular programming languages for video game QA testers are Python, C++, and C#. Don’t worry – You can still land a job as a game QA tester without knowing how to code. But if you are interested in upgrading your skills, you can always take an online quality assurance engineering course.
Lastly, you need knowledge of editing software like OBS and Bandicam to record gameplay footage and videos. Basic knowledge of how emulators like Cemu or Dolphin work is also a plus.

How much will you make if you become a video game QA tester? The average annual salary in the United States is $87,131. Top earners can make up to $400,000 per year, though most testers earn an annual amount between $25,000 and $31,000. As you advance in your career and become more professional, your salary will also increase to match your qualifications.
